1. Rustic architectural signature amidst pristine nature
1.1. Harmonious interplay between bamboo and wood in design
Camia Resort & Spa is located in the Ong Lang beach area, Phu Quoc, boasting architecture inspired by natural materials such as wood, bamboo, and coconut leaves. The villas and bungalows are arranged according to the existing terrain, interspersed with stone-paved paths, creating a gentle feeling when moving between the forest and sea spaces. The overall architecture aims for harmony, helping the resort blend into the surrounding island landscape.
The open design with large glass doors and private balconies allows the sea breeze to enter every living space. Every morning upon waking, guests can fully experience the scent of the sea through the sunlight and cool breeze. The dark-toned wooden interior combined with natural bamboo colors brings a warm feeling, maintaining a rustic yet sophisticated style in every detail.

3.2. Best time to watch the sunset at Ong Lang Beach
One of the memorable experiences at Camia Resort & Spa Phu Quoc is watching the sunset over Ong Lang Beach. The period from 5:30 PM to 6:30 PM is usually when the afternoon light begins to color the sea and sky. This is a suitable time for guests to leisurely enjoy the atmosphere and capture gentle moments.
Guests can choose to watch the sunset from the sea-facing restaurant area or stroll along the sandy beach near the resort. The rocky areas along the coast also offer interesting perspectives as sunlight reflects on the water. The quiet atmosphere makes the experience more complete without needing to travel far.
During the dry season, from around November to April, the weather in Phu Quoc is usually stable and has little rain. This creates favorable conditions for clearly observing the sky's color changes at dusk. Light clothing in neutral colors will help guests blend into the natural scenery of the island.

4.2. Sunset Town
Sunset Town is located in the southern part of Phu Quoc island, developed as a complex for entertainment, resort, and coastal art performances. This area features fireworks displays twice every night, running 365 days a year, associated with two main performances: Kiss of the Sea and Symphony of the Sea. The stable nighttime schedule makes it a suitable connecting point after daytime island activities.
At Sunset Town, the Symphony of the Sea show takes place in the Kiss of the Love area, while the Kiss of the Sea show is held at a nearby stage. Both programs utilize elements of sound, light, water, fire, and fireworks, creating an experience focused on the evening. The combination of shows, the coastal square, and dining services offers visitors more options when staying in Phu Quoc for multiple days.

The architectural highlight of the area is the Kiss Bridge (Cau Hon), a structure with two bridge arms extending towards the sea but not quite touching. This design creates a clear visual effect at sunset, when sunlight passes through the gap between the two bridge arms. Since late 2023, the Kiss Bridge (Cau Hon) has become one of the most talked-about photo spots in the south of Phu Quoc island.
